ICD-10 Code C70.0 |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ges Symptoms, Diagnosis, Billing

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ges refers to a cancerous tumor that arises in the protective membranes covering the brain and spinal cord. This condition is clinically significant due to its potential to cause neurological deficits, increased intracranial pressure, and other serious complications. Accurate coding with ICD-10 Code C70.0 is essential for proper diagnosis, documentation, medical billing, and public health reporting, ensuring that healthcare providers can effectively manage and treat this serious condition.

What is ICD-10 Code C70.0 for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ges?

ICD-10 Code C70.0 represents a malignant neoplasm located in the cerebral meninges, which are the protective layers surrounding the brain. This code is used when documenting cases of primary or secondary tumors affecting the meninges, and it is crucial for accurate clinical documentation and billing. It should be applied when a patient presents with symptoms indicative of a meningeal tumor, such as headaches, seizures, or neurological deficits.

ICD-10 Code C70.0 – Clinical Definition and Explanation of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ges

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ges is primarily caused by the uncontrolled growth of abnormal cells in the meninges, which can be primary or metastatic in nature. The progression of this condition can lead to significant morbidity, necessitating prompt medical intervention. Early diagnosis and treatment are critical to improve patient outcomes.

Key Clinical Features:

  • Headaches that may worsen over time.
  • Neurological deficits such as weakness or sensory loss.
  • Seizures, which may be new-onset.
  • Signs of increased intracranial pressure, including nausea and vomiting.

      How to Document Symptoms of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ges (ICD-10 C70.0) in SOAP Notes

      Subjective:

      • Patient reports persistent headaches, worsening over the past month.
      • History of new-onset seizures occurring twice in the last week.
      • Complaints of nausea and occasional vomiting.
      • Patient expresses concern about recent changes in vision.

      Objective:

      • Neurological examination reveals weakness in the right upper extremity.
      • CT scan shows a mass in the meninges.
      • Vital signs stable; no signs of acute distress.
      • Fundoscopic exam indicates papilledema.

      SOAP Note Guidelines for Diagnosing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ges (ICD-10 Code C70.0)

      Assessment:

      • Diagnosis: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ges, confirmed by imaging.
      • Severity: Moderate, with neurological deficits present.
      • ICD-10 Code: C70.0.
      • Contributing factors: Recent onset of seizures and headaches.

      Plan:

      • Refer to oncology for evaluation of treatment options.
      • Initiate corticosteroid therapy to manage symptoms.
      • Schedule follow-up imaging in 4 weeks to assess treatment response.
      • Educate patient on signs of increased intracranial pressure.

      ICD-10 Code C70.0 in Medical Billing and Insurance for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ges

      ICD-10 Code C70.0 is critical in medical billing, particularly in hospital, ER, or oncology settings, to ensure accurate claims processing.

      Billing Notes:

      • Document all relevant clinical findings and treatment plans to support the use of C70.0.
      • Use this code in conjunction with procedure codes for surgical interventions or imaging studies.
      • Ensure that the diagnosis is clearly linked to the patient's symptoms in the medical record.
      • Review payer-specific guidelines for any additional documentation requirements.

      Common CPT Pairings:

      CPT CodeDescription
      61510Craniotomy, for excision of tumor, brain.
      77014Radiologic guidance for placement of radiation therapy.
      96450Chemotherapy administration, intravenous.

      Frequently Asked Questions

      Common Questions About Using ICD-10 Code C70.0 for Mal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ges

      What are the common symptoms of mal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ges?

      Common symptoms include persistent headaches, seizures, neurological deficits, and signs of increased intracranial pressure such as nausea and vomiting.

      How is malignant neoplasm of cerebral meninges diagnosed?

      Diagnosis typically involves imaging studies such as MRI or CT scans, along with neurological examinations to assess symptoms and deficits.

      What treatment options are available for this condition?

      Treatment may include surgical resection, radiation therapy, and chemotherapy, depending on the tumor's characteristics and location.

      How does ICD-10 Code C70.0 impact billing?

      ICD-10 Code C70.0 is essential for accurate billing, as it links the diagnosis to the services provided, ensuring proper reimbursement for treatment.
